Musky Rod Reel Combo: The Ultimate Buying Guide

So, you want to catch a musky? Great! These fish are huge and exciting. You will need the right gear. That means a good musky rod and reel combo. This guide helps you find the perfect one.

Key Features to Look For

You need to find a combo that is strong. Muskies are powerful fish.

  • Rod Length: Musky rods are long. They are usually between 7 and 9 feet. A longer rod helps you cast far. It also helps you control the fish.
  • Rod Power: Musky rods are heavy. Look for “heavy” or “extra heavy” power. This tells you how strong the rod is.
  • Rod Action: Action refers to how the rod bends. Fast action rods bend near the tip. Slow action rods bend all the way down. Fast action rods are good for setting the hook.
  • Reel Size: You need a big reel. It needs to hold a lot of strong line. Look for reels designed for musky fishing.
  • Gear Ratio: The gear ratio shows how fast the reel retrieves line. A faster ratio helps you reel in lures quickly.
  • Line Capacity: Make sure the reel holds enough line. Musky fishing needs heavy line.
Important Materials

The materials make a big difference. They affect strength and feel.

  • Rod Blank: This is the main part of the rod. Graphite and fiberglass are common materials. Graphite is sensitive and strong. Fiberglass is more flexible. Some rods use a mix of both.
  • Rod Guides: These rings guide the line. Look for guides made of durable materials. Ceramic guides are a good choice.
  • Reel Body: Reels are made of different materials. Aluminum is strong and durable. Graphite can be lighter.
  • Drag System: The drag controls how much line the fish can take. A smooth drag is very important. It prevents the line from breaking.

Musky Rod Reel Combo: Frequently Asked Questions

Here are some common questions about musky rod and reel combos.

Q: What is the best rod length for musky fishing?

A: Most anglers use rods between 7 and 9 feet long. The best length depends on your fishing style and location.

Q: What type of reel is best for musky fishing?

A: Baitcasting reels are the most popular choice. They are strong and can hold a lot of line.

Q: What is the best line to use for musky fishing?

A: Braided line is the most common choice. It is strong and has no stretch.

Q: How much should I spend on a musky rod and reel combo?

A: Good combos start around $200. You can spend much more. The price depends on the quality and features.

Q: How do I care for my musky rod and reel combo?

A: Rinse the rod and reel with fresh water after each use. Lubricate the reel. Store the combo in a safe place.

Q: What rod action is best for musky fishing?

A: Fast action rods are popular. They help you set the hook quickly.

Q: What is the difference between rod power and rod action?

A: Rod power tells you how strong the rod is. Rod action tells you where the rod bends.

Q: What does “gear ratio” mean on a reel?

A: The gear ratio tells you how fast the reel retrieves line. A higher gear ratio means faster retrieval.
